Ingredients for Irresistible Spicy Spaghetti

  • Spaghetti pasta – 400 g (14 oz)

  • Olive oil – 3 tablespoons

  • Garlic cloves, finely minced – 6 cloves

  • Onion, finely chopped – 1 medium

  • Crushed tomatoes – 800 g (28 oz)

  • Tomato paste – 2 tablespoons

  • Red chili flakes – 2 teaspoons (adjust to taste)

  • Paprika – 1 teaspoon

  • Cayenne pepper – ½ teaspoon (optional for extra heat)

  • Dried oregano – 1 teaspoon

  • Dried basil – 1 teaspoon

  • Salt – 1½ teaspoons (or to taste)

  • Black pepper – 1 teaspoon

  • Sugar – 1 teaspoon (to balance acidity)

  • Pasta cooking water – ½ cup (as needed)

  • Fresh parsley, chopped – 3 tablespoons

  • Grated hard cheese or dairy-free alternative – ½ cup (optional)


Step-by-Step Instructions: Building Bold, Fiery Flavor

Step 1: Cook the Spaghetti to the Perfect Bite

Begin by bringing a large pot of water to a rolling boil. This step is more important than it seems, as properly boiling water ensures the spaghetti cooks evenly and develops the right texture. Once the water is boiling vigorously, add 1 tablespoon of salt. The water should taste slightly salty, which helps season the pasta from the inside out. Add 400 g (14 oz) of spaghetti and cook according to the package instructions until al dente, meaning the pasta is tender but still has a slight bite in the center. Before draining, carefully reserve ½ cup of the pasta cooking water. This starchy water will later help bind the sauce to the spaghetti, creating a smooth and cohesive finish.

Step 2: Sauté the Onion for a Flavorful Base

While the pasta cooks, heat 3 tablespoons of olive oil in a large, deep pan over medium heat. Once the oil is warm, add 1 medium onion, finely chopped. Sauté the onion for 4–5 minutes, stirring occasionally, until it becomes soft and translucent. This process gently releases the onion’s natural sweetness, which plays a crucial role in balancing the heat of the spices later on. Avoid rushing this step, as properly softened onions create a rich, flavorful foundation for the sauce.


Step 3: Add Garlic Without Burning

Next, add 6 cloves of minced garlic to the pan. Stir continuously and cook for about 30 seconds, just until fragrant. Garlic burns quickly, and burnt garlic can introduce bitterness into the sauce. Keeping the heat at medium and stirring constantly ensures the garlic releases its aroma and flavor without overpowering the dish. This step infuses the oil with a deep, savory aroma that defines the character of the sauce.


Step 4: Concentrate Flavor with Tomato Paste

Stir in 2 tablespoons of tomato paste and cook for 1 minute. Cooking the tomato paste briefly allows it to caramelize slightly, removing its raw taste and intensifying its natural sweetness. This step adds depth and richness to the sauce, giving it a more complex, well-rounded flavor that supports the bold spices to come.


Step 5: Build the Spicy Tomato Sauce

Now add 800 g (28 oz) of crushed tomatoes to the pan, followed by 2 teaspoons of red chili flakes, 1 teaspoon paprika, ½ te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ional), 1 teaspoon dried oregano, 1 teaspoon dried basil, 1½ teaspoons salt, 1 teaspoon black pepper, and 1 teaspoon sugar. Stir thoroughly to combine all ingredients. The sugar balances the acidity of the tomatoes, while the spices layer heat and warmth throughout the sauce. At this stage, the sauce should look vibrant and smell aromatic, signaling the start of its transformation into something bold and irresistible.


Step 6: Simmer for Depth and Balance

Reduce the heat to low and let the sauce simmer gently for 15–20 minutes, stirring occasionally. This slow simmer allows the flavors to meld together, softening the sharpness of the tomatoes and rounding out the spice. If the sauce thickens too much, add a little of the reserved pasta water, a few tablespoons at a time. The starch in the water helps emulsify the sauce, creating a silky texture that will cling beautifully to the spaghetti.


Step 7: Combine Pasta and Sauce

Add the cooked spaghetti directly to the pan with the sauce. Toss gently but thoroughly, ensuring every strand is evenly coated. This step is essential for achieving a cohesive dish where the pasta and sauce feel like one unified element rather than separate components. If needed, add a final splash of pasta water to loosen the sauce and enhance its glossy finish.

Step 8: Finish and Serve Immediately

Remove the pan from heat and garnish the spaghetti with 3 tablespoons of freshly chopped parsley and ½ cup of grated hard cheese or a dairy-free alternative, if desired. Serve immediately while hot. Tips for Perfect Fiery Flavor

The key to a great spicy spaghetti lies in layering heat rather than overwhelming the dish. Start with moderate chili flakes and adjust as the sauce simmers. Using pasta water helps emulsify the sauce, giving it a silky texture that clings to every strand. If you prefer a smoky undertone, slightly increase the paprika. Always taste as you go to ensure the heat complements, not dominates, the flavors.


Frequently Asked Questions

1. How can I control the spice level without losing flavor?

Controlling spice is all about balance. If you’re sensitive to heat, start with 1 teaspoon of red chili flakes and omit the cayenne pepper. The paprika and garlic will still provide depth and warmth without excessive heat. For those who love bold flavors, you can increase chili flakes gradually during simmering. This approach allows the spice to bloom naturally in the sauce rather than hitting all at once, ensuring the dish remains flavorful instead of overwhelmingly hot.

2. Can I add vegetables to this spicy spaghetti?

Absolutely. Vegetables pair beautifully with this dish and add texture and nutrition. Bell peppers, zucchini, mushrooms, or spinach are excellent choices. Sauté firmer vegetables like peppers and mushrooms with the onions, and stir in leafy greens like spinach during the final minutes of cooking. The vegetables absorb the spicy sauce, enhancing the overall flavor while keeping the dish hearty and satisfying.

3. What type of pasta works best if I don’t have spaghetti?

While spaghetti is classic, other long pastas such as linguine or fettuccine work just as well. Short pastas like penne or rigatoni are also great options, especially if you enjoy sauce pooling inside each piece. The key is choosing pasta with enough surface area to hold onto the spicy sauce, ensuring every bite delivers that fiery kick.

4. How do I store and reheat leftovers without losing texture?

Store leftover spicy spaghetti in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. When reheating, add a splash of water or olive oil and warm it gently on the stovetop over low heat. Stir frequently to prevent sticking and to revive the sauce’s silky consistency. Avoid overheating, as this can dry out the pasta and dull the flavors.
